Guiding Principles

The content of this section is based on four Guiding Principles which are:

  1. A sense of safety and security is a basic human need.  When this need is not met, one experiences a heightened survival response that results in various autonomic reactions including distraction, agitation, and physical ailments. 
  1. Students who feel safe and secure are more likely to focus on academic tasks.  Research shows this sense of safety and security in the school environment increases academic proficiency.
  1. A safe and secure school environment is the right of every child, family, and community.

   4.   Proactive policies and procedures which promote a positive school

         environment reduce the incidence and prevalence of bullying behavior.
